Gears of War Ultimate Edition 5 GB Patch Now Live, Fixes Boomshot Hit Registration

Warzone returns as permanent playlist while Assassination is limited time mode.

Posted By | On 23rd, Feb. 2016

Gears of War Ultimate Edition

The Coalition has released a large new title update for Gears of War: Ultimate Edition which fixes several errors and changes up certain multiplayer playlists.

Along with improving registration with the Boomshot, the update allows kills in Social playlists to count towards the “Seriously” Achievement. This means you won’t have to grind out the Achievement in single-player. Other fixes include one for long matchmaking times, improvements for the Left Trigger issue, fixing hit detection when shooting an enemy seeking cover in the Clocktower’s top pillars, and much more.

Blitz mode has also been moved from the Competitive to Social playlist while Warzone returns as a permanent playlist. Assassination is a playlist for a limited time while a new Competitive Team Deathmatch playlist has been added. You can check out the full patch notes here for more information.
